Mastering the Code


At its core, this device functions as a Morse code electronic keyer, translating standard keyboard input into CW signals. This capability is fundamental for modern amateur radio operations, bridging the gap between digital input and traditional radio communication. The unit supports various WPM (Words Per Minute) settings, allowing operators to adjust the speed to match their proficiency level. This adaptability is critical for effective training.

For new operators, the ability to practice at slower speeds is invaluable. It builds muscle memory and recognition skills. More experienced users can push their limits, refining their speed and accuracy. The system provides consistent, reliable keying for all skill levels.

Seamless Integration


Power input is handled via a Type-C USB port, a modern and widely adopted standard, ensuring broad compatibility with existing power adapters and cables. This choice simplifies power management, as many users already possess Type-C chargers for other devices. A single cable handles power.

Connectivity for keyboard input is via a standard USB-A port, allowing connection of a conventional USB keyboard for text entry. This universal compatibility means operators can use their preferred keyboard, enhancing comfort and familiarity during long practice or transmission sessions. Any standard USB keyboard works.
